Skip to content

Commit f548a8e

Browse files
committed
EndpointSlice
1 parent df92b2f commit f548a8e

File tree

1 file changed

+12
-0
lines changed

1 file changed

+12
-0
lines changed

api/restHandler/AppListingRestHandler.go

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1662,6 +1662,18 @@ func (handler AppListingRestHandlerImpl) fetchResourceTree(w http.ResponseWriter
16621662
}
16631663
}
16641664
}
1665+
if portHolder.ManifestResponse.Manifest.Object["kind"] == "EndpointSlice" {
1666+
if portHolder.ManifestResponse.Manifest.Object["ports"] != nil {
1667+
endPointsSlicePorts := portHolder.ManifestResponse.Manifest.Object["ports"].([]interface{})
1668+
for _, val := range endPointsSlicePorts {
1669+
_portNumber := val.(map[string]interface{})["port"]
1670+
portNumber := _portNumber.(int64)
1671+
if portNumber != 0 {
1672+
ports = append(ports, portNumber)
1673+
}
1674+
}
1675+
}
1676+
}
16651677
}
16661678
if err != nil {
16671679
handler.logger.Errorw("error in fetching manifest", "err", err)

0 commit comments

Comments
 (0)